What to check before for buildings with high tenant retention in NYC

  • Expect to find buildings where tenants tend to stay longer, indicating satisfaction with the community and management.
  • Confirm specifics about lease terms, including duration and any fees upfront to avoid surprises later.
  • Watch for any restrictions that may come with longer leases, such as penalties for breaking the lease early.
  • Inquire about any recent renovations or management changes that could impact your living experience.
  • Consider visiting the property to meet potential neighbors and get a feel for the community atmosphere.
